Profile Summary:
Provide essential support to customers and shipping agents by addressing their queries and concerns while actively identifying new business opportunities. Offer daily assistance to customers and coordinate their requirements ensuring seamless communication and collaboration across various business units.
iKey Roles & Responsibilities
- Conduct daily follow-up calls with customers regarding bookings and circulate the Cargo Booking Forecast (CBF).
- Independently coordinate customer bookings (Client service and third-party) while verifying customer lists and issuing voyage No Objection Certificates (NOCs).
- Communicate customer and agent booking requirements (Client services and third-party services) and update all systems accordingly with daily vessel updates.
- Serve as the key liaison between internal departments external agents and service providers to relay customer requirements.
- Handle customer rate inquiries send rate quotations and ensure error-free system updates.
- Identify non-active customers address concerns and work to restore regular support.
- Monitor weekly and monthly customer loading averages to ensure continued engagement.
- Send arrival notices and NOCs to customers before vessel arrival for import shipments on third-party
- Perform any other job-related duties as assigned.
